Mangalore, Karnataka vs Shkoder Climate & Distance Between

Albania flag
  • The distance between Mangalore, Karnataka, India and Shkoder, Albania is approximately 6,214 km or 3,861 mi.
  • To reach Mangalore, Karnataka in this distance one would set out from Shkoder bearing 104.5° or ESE and follow the great circles arc to approach Mangalore, Karnataka bearing 132.5° or SE .
  • Mangalore, Karnataka has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am) whereas Shkoder has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a).
  • The annual mean temperature is 12.4 °C (22.3°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 16.5 °C (29.7°F) less in Mangalore, Karnataka.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to semicont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1422 mm (56 in) more which is equivalent to 1422 l/m² (34.9 US gal/ft²) or 14,220,000 l/ha (1,520,212 US gal/ac) more. About 1 2/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 24.7° higher in Mangalore, Karnataka than in Shkoder.
  • Relative humidity levels are 20.8% higher.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 16.6°C (29.9°F) higher.
